These witch broom cupcakes are playful, easy, and right on theme.
A swirl of frosting becomes the broom top, while a pretzel stick creates the handle.
It’s a fun way to mix sweet and salty flavors into one adorable dessert.
Perfect for Halloween bake sales or kids’ parties.
Even better, they look fancy without the effort.

30. Melted Witch Cupcakes (Halloween cupcake ideas easy)
Photo Credit: sixsistersstuff.com
These melted witch cupcakes are a Halloween classic everyone loves.
A pool of green frosting and a candy hat make it look like the witch melted right on your plate.
They’re creative, easy, and sure to impress guests.
Each bite is rich, sweet, and full of chocolate flavor.
Perfect for Halloween parties or themed baking nights.
